WebHedda practices for her shooting at Judge Brack by mock firing at General Gabler’s portrait, a stage direction not found in Ibsen’s text but one that is perhaps justified as the playing … Hedda Gabler is a play written by Norwegian playwright Henrik Ibsen. The world premiere was staged on 31 January 1891 at the Residenztheater in Munich. Ibsen himself was in attendance, although he remained back-stage.
